Understanding Common Account Verification Challenges on Amazon
Account verification on Amazon serves as a crucial safeguard against fraud and ensures that sellers maintain a trustworthy environment for customers. One prevalent issue arises from discrepancies between the account information provided and the documentation submitted. For instance, if a seller’s bank account name does not match the name registered on their Amazon account, it can trigger a verification failure. Similarly, if the seller’s address is not consistent across various documents, this can lead to additional scrutiny and delays in the verification process.
Another common challenge involves the quality and clarity of the documentation provided. Amazon requires specific forms of identification and proof of address, which must be submitted in a precise format. Sellers often face issues when scanned documents are blurry, incomplete, or not in the preferred file format. This lack of clarity can lead to rejection of the appeal, even when the information is accurate. As such, ensuring that documentation is not only relevant but also meets Amazon’s quality standards is crucial to avoid unnecessary complications.
Lastly, Amazon employs advanced algorithms and manual reviews to identify suspicious activity. New sellers, in particular, may be flagged due to a lack of sales history or previous account issues. This could result in increased verification requirements that differ from more established sellers. Understanding these nuances can help sellers anticipate potential red flags that may arise during the verification process, allowing them to prepare documentation and information that aligns with Amazon’s expectations.
Effective Strategies for Resolving Verification Issues in Appeals
When faced with account verification challenges, the first step is to meticulously review the requirements outlined by Amazon. Familiarizing yourself with the specific documentation needed for your appeal is essential. Take note of any feedback provided by Amazon during the initial verification attempt, as this can guide you in addressing the specific concerns raised. Gather all necessary documents, such as government-issued identification, bank statements, or utility bills, ensuring that they clearly match the information in your Amazon account profile.
Once you have collected the required documentation, focus on presenting your appeal in a clear and concise manner. Write a professional appeal letter that outlines the steps you have taken to address the verification issues. Clearly state any discrepancies and provide a rational explanation. Highlight corrections, if any, and emphasize your commitment to compliance with Amazon’s policies. A well-structured appeal can make a considerable difference in how your case is evaluated by Amazon’s support team.
Lastly, patience and persistence are key in navigating account verification issues. After submitting your appeal, allow some time for Amazon to process it. If you do not receive a response within the expected timeframe, consider following up with a polite inquiry. Maintaining a professional tone throughout your communications is vital, as it reflects your dedication to resolving the situation amicably. Remember that the appeals process can be iterative; learning from past experiences can better prepare you for future challenges.
